XRP jumps 39% weekly as Bitcoin posts its biggest weekly gain in two years
Macro & Markets ·
Bitcoin briefly topped $79,000 while XRP led a broad rally across major tokens, marking one of the sharpest weekly moves in crypto markets in recent memory.
Bitcoin's advance this week marked its largest weekly gain in two years, according to The Block, which reported the token briefly crossed $79,000 before the rally broadened into altcoins. XRP posted a 39% weekly gain, outpacing Bitcoin's move and positioning it as the standout performer among major tokens tracked during the surge.
The rally was not confined to Bitcoin and XRP. Other tokens including HYPE, ZEC, and LINK also participated in the broader upswing, suggesting the move extended beyond a single asset and reflected wider risk appetite returning to crypto markets. Separate coverage placed the scale of XRP's move even higher, with CryptoPotato reporting a 40% surge in XRP within a 48-hour window alongside Bitcoin reaching a three-month high and Ethereum topping $2,400.
The moves coincided with reports tying the rally to a US Treasury liquidity support announcement, with Bitcoin rallying to $80,000, Ethereum rising to $2,390, and XRP surging 40% in that context. Separately, whale accumulation activity was reported around the same period, with large holders adding more than 300 million XRP tokens over 96 hours and accounting for 53% of buy orders as the token moved toward $1.30, pointing to concentrated buying pressure from large investors during the rally window.
